An opportunity has arisen for dynamic individuals with an eye for detail to join our team in the role of Quality Controller.The purpose of this role is to carry out quality control checks on incoming raw materials, outgoing finished products and online production checks to ensure our fresh fruit products meet our internal and customer specifications.
Responsibilities Include:
Inspection of fresh produce on arrival, on production lines and on despatch; ensuring product is correctly packed and positive release is carried out
Carrying out quality related inspection checks such as pressure and brix testing using the appropriate equipment and recording test results
Utilising the company IT software to create stock reports
Managing workload according to customer order sheets.
Checking of produce labels for accuracy and as per specification
Completing any necessary documentation in compliance with any requirements
Maintaining excellent levels of hygiene standards
Repetitive manual handling of products (up to 18kg)
Monitoring the productivity of our Production Operatives, providing training, support and feedback to drive improved performance
